For too many years, pilothouse sailing yachts had a clunky look, with an oversized salon projecting well above the deck, seemingly attached as an afterthought to the otherwise clean lines of a capable ocean-going vessel. However, when Bruce Farr and his renowned crew of designers, naval architects and engineers produced Design #373, the Farr 50 Pilot House, in 1997, they raised the bar for this particular design. They also heightened expectations for owners, who prized excellent performance under sail, offshore reliability across a wide range of weather and sea conditions, and accommodations that blended home-style amenities and carefully planned spaces.
Only 25 of the 50PH models were built, and they were constructed to a very high standard, by BSI Marine in Lysekil, Sweden, and sold through Boat Sales International UK. For that reason, they were and continue to be sought after in global brokerage listings. The enduring appeal of the 50PH shouldn’t come as a surprise, considering Farr’s designs have long dominated offshore sailing in pure racing and competitive cruising arenas alike, ranging from the Volvo Ocean Race to the Atlantic Rally for Cruisers (ARC).
The most striking features of the boat are the salon and pilothouse, which is equipped with safety glass windows for spectacular views. A raised wraparound settee for up to six passengers is served by a large table for dining.
The boat also has very comfortable accommodations, including a large master stateroom aft, equipped with a king-sized island berth, settee, hanging wardrobe and ensuite head with separate shower. Access is through a portside passageway.
